| Abstract |
As quantum network hardware has made significant progress in recent years, there is an increasing focus on enhancing both the infrastructure and the corresponding software of quantum networks. To establish a comprehensive quantum network, two key stacks are employed: the quantum node stack and the quantum control stack. In this survey, we first clearly distinguish between the quantum network and the quantum internet. Then we provide a comprehensive survey of the state-of-the-art and use cases for quantum network stacks. Regarding the quantum control stack, we categorize it into traditional and programmable approaches. We further explore the current research challenges associated with each method to inspire ongoing investigation.
